I work at red robin, and a REALLY nutritional meal there is the Ensenada Chicken Platter with the balsamic vingerette as the dressing. its basically a plate with two grilled chicken breasts, and a side salad.

Another good choice is any of the salads with the dressing onthe side. It annoys me too that they don't have nutritional info for the menu, but I've asked the owner a couple times what some healthy choices were. Hope this helps!
